Schultz: Jalen Carter swelled to 323. He ought to tackle considerations earlier than the NFL Draft

ATHENS, GA – There are numerous expertise evaluators across the NFL who consider that Jalen Carter is the very best participant obtainable within the NFL Draft. However whether or not he goes first, fifth, or someplace considerably south within the draft relies upon largely on whether or not he: 1) has a serious bodily and psychological shift from the place he seems to be sitting now, or 2) a group locks up. His expertise and betting on him would be the participant he could be.
Georgia held its professional day on Wednesday for its high scoring prospects. It’s considered one of a sequence of necessary occasions for gamers who performed an efficient four-month interview to indicate off the very best variations of themselves.
However the very best model of Jalen Carter was not on show. NFL officers, coaches, and members of the media in attendance noticed an chubby Carter huffing and puffing via the few drills that had been arrange for the defensemen on the Georgia internship facility. He didn’t take part in some other expertise assessments, nor the 40-yard sprint. He additionally, not surprisingly, selected to not communicate to the media, as did different taking part Bulldogs gamers.
Carter weighed 323 kilos, in response to an unnamed league supply, so he may communicate freely. That is 13 kilos heavier than what was listed throughout the Georgia season. It’s additionally 9 kilos heavier than the 314 he weighed within the Exploration Pack two weeks in the past. It clearly wasn’t the 9 kilos of added muscle. He regarded flabby. He regarded excessively curvy after the exercises. He appeared like a danger to any group which may resolve to supply him a signing bonus of over $20 million.
Jalen Carter was chubby and windy throughout practices at Georgia’s professional day on Wednesday. (John Bazemore / Related Press)
Some NFL officers consider Carter’s very best enjoying weight is underneath 310 kilos to make higher use of his passing and athleticism expertise. Massively proficient gamers can’t attain their athletic expectations if they permit their our bodies to change into temples of loss of life. The Wednesday that adopted Carter’s determination to not apply on set made it worse, despite the fact that he did interview particular person groups there.
“Anybody who takes him in has to know what he’s entering into,” mentioned the league supply. “Everybody should do their due diligence after which decide.”

At his peak, Carter was a dominant participant who had a viral second within the SEC Championship Sport when he lifted LSU quarterback Jayden Daniels with one arm whereas throwing the #1 tag with the opposite. He was a First Staff All-American, All-SEC Staff, and every thing each NFL group wants and desires.
However there are necessary questions now.
We will’t know the place that is going. Placing apart the 2 misdemeanors with which Carter was charged—racing and reckless driving, stemming from the accident that killed Georgia teammate Devin Willock and recruiting assistant Chandler Lecroy—main questions on Carter which have existed amongst skilled scouts since via the season relate to her consistency and work ethic.
The payoff, as Georgia coach Kirby Sensible emphasised Wednesday, was that the defensive sort out handled accidents throughout the season and, in reality, must be applauded for being the other of laziness.
“I get quite a lot of questions on Galen, which had been most likely inevitable anyway,” Sensible mentioned. “I bought quite a lot of questions on (first choose) Travon Walker when he bought out. However with the (accident) scenario, there are most likely extra questions and extra direct ones, and I’m simply attempting to be trustworthy and speak in regards to the experiences we’ve had right here. Galen didn’t have to return again To play after his first harm, nor after his second harm, and both manner he wished to beat that harm and begged us to place him within the video games he bought injured. So the aggressive persona he confirmed was actually good.”
Right here’s the catch, and it additionally applies to Stetson-Bennett’s misdemeanor public intoxication in Dallas in late January. NFL groups are protecting rating now – not simply how they give the impression of being however how they act. It’s exhausting sufficient to resolve who spends a draft and who offers the cash. However when a man does silly issues in public — and a participant like Carter can affect the course of a sport — it offers the group pause.
And Wednesday was not a very good look. There have been already questions lingering about the place Carter may need been psychologically after the accident, and the way he has handled himself being within the damaging highlight so instantly.
Even Sensible admitted, “I can solely think about realizing what he’s coping with internally, as a survivor of a tragic accident, and realizing the end result of that accident. There are some psychological well being issues you could have to have the ability to assist with. I can’t communicate for what he’s going via. It to reply these questions. However we will definitely attempt to help him as a lot as we will.”
Stetson Bennett, who has his personal set of inquiries to cope with, defended Carter. He has been referred to as “particular” and “rock”.
“We all know what comes with the territory we’re in proper now, the issues that can finish, the conditions we put ourselves in, and the way we take accountability,” Bennett mentioned. “Being a grown man is our job. So I believe he will get it. … He is aware of he’s the very best on the sphere however he nonetheless does issues the proper manner. He’s in the proper gaps for the backers to slot in. I don’t thoughts the vary protection. It’s clear he can get Quarterback. He’s shocking, he’s highly effective in his shock. Good to the foot. In the event you take a look at him, he’s all the time able of energy. That’s why he blows folks off the road.”
Every thing is correct – when Carter is at his greatest. However this wasn’t the Carter we noticed Wednesday. He has a month earlier than the draft to get in form and ease his fears. He has a month to comprehend he’s within the midst of a job interview and has simply walked in in a T-shirt and flip flops trying like he simply bought off the bed.
